Pit Viper kicked off its annual “12 Days of Turbo” giveaway last week, and the first prize set the tone early. The opener ran November 14–15 and featured an X-Products Arc Flamethrower, complete with a 3.5-gallon fuel backpack and a fire-spitting reach of up to 30 feet. It’s the kind of high-octane giveaway that fits neatly into Pit Viper’s larger-than-life brand personality and serves as the launchpad for the lineup still unfolding.

The First Prize: An X-Products Arc Flamethrower
X-Products is known for specialty hardware built for spectacle, and the Arc Flamethrower is exactly that. The full kit includes the flamethrower and backpack tank system, designed to push a steady stream of gasoline fire across open space. Pit Viper leaned into the absurdity with its announcement, framing the giveaway as an intentionally outrageous start to the series.
What’s Coming Next

Since the campaign spans November 14–25, several prizes remain active or upcoming. Each one runs in its own two-day window unless noted otherwise:
- Nov 16–17: Two custom P-51 E-Bikes splatter-painted by Pit Viper founder Chuck Mumford, plus four pairs of matching custom-painted Originals.
- Nov 18–19: A one-year supply of Mountain Dew, split between Original Green and Baja Blast.

How to Follow the Series
Each giveaway is hosted through Pit Viper’s website, where participants can enter by submitting an email address during the designated window. The brand’s social channels are also promoting individual prize drops and partner spotlights.
